Hello guys,
I am missing entry and exit stamps on my passport, unfortunately the immigration officers of the country I visited did not stamp my passport when I entered and when I left, however when I re-entered Canada the officer at Pearson airport stamped my passport. I heard that at the interview the officer looks at the entry and exit stamps in the passport to vefify the travel dates in my application. Is it a big problem for me since I don't have the stamps, what are the consequences?
I have lost the ticket and boarding passes since this was back in 2012. What should I do to avoid any negative consequences?

I am a february applicant but I decided to ask in this thread as most of you guys have gone through the test and interview.

Thanks,

Lumumba.

Have the CBSA report on hand with you before the test, make sure they match what you reported on the residence calculator and you should be good. Missing stamps from passport are no big deals. It's the other way around that's an issue: Found stamps(absences) in the passport that are not reported.
